On an unrelated note, I find myself a little bothered by something in fic, and I'm wondering if I'm the only one. It's when names are used unnecessarily in dialog, like this:

"Ray, could you buy some milk on the way home?"
"Sure, Fraser."

In real life, people don't use names like this when there's no uncertainty about whom they're addressing, do they? At least I don't. And I get that it's an easy way to indicate who's speaking, but I think that can be done in other ways. I just recently started thinking about this, and now when I reread my own older fic, sometimes I edit out the names.

Anyway, it's just a small thing, and easy to tune out when I read, but I was wondering if anyone else had thought about this. Does anyone disagree?

In real life, people don't use names like this when there's no uncertainty about whom they're addressing, do they?

No, but they do it a lot on TV and in movies, to give the viewers a chance to learn and remember the names, I think. (Heh -- [livejournal.com profile] miss_zedem thinks it's an American thing; I think it's a TV thing. Perhaps a combination?) It seems to be very much part of the speech patterns of DS, which I think is why it ends up in fic so much, but yeah, I always try to cut down if I can. You don't need it in fic the same way you do in canon.

Though, otoh, in canon, you can often tell who someone's talking to by eyeline/body language, whereas in fic you have to somehow make that explicit.
